Disney Disconnects Mobile ESPN

Mobile ESPN’s plug has been pulled after less than a year in the marketplace - and months of rate adjustments and losses of at least $25 million.

Chase TV Ads to Target Individual Households

Chase is planning a large-scale addressable TV advertising buy for early next year, making it the first major marketer to deliver unique TV advertising at the household address level. What makes this campaign unique is that it’s not zip-code or neighborhood level targeting - Chase will deliver unique TV advertising to each household served.

Oprah Pulls Major Advertisers to XM

Oprah & Friends radio channel, which launched September 25, has brought 13 new advertisers to XM, making it, in terms of ad sales, its most successful channel launch to date.

MyNetworkTV Ratings Dismal

MyNetworkTV, the network created from the stations left out of the WB-UPN merger, launched earlier this month, getting a two-week jump on the new television season. In spite of that, the launch was disappointing, and ratings have spiralled downward since then.

Tribune Co. Hires Consultants to Explore Options

Tribune Co. has taken another step toward the sale or break-up of the company, having announced yesterday that is has hired financial advisors Merrill Lynch and Citigroup to help determine its choices.

GM Shifts Pan-European Media Account to Aegis

GM has shifted its $750 million pan-European media account away from Interpublic Group of Cos. to Aegis.

Major League Soccer to Sell Ads on Jersey Fronts

Major League Soccer will be the first American major team sports league to sell advertising space on the fronts of players’ jerseys.
